mongodb数据库
文章平均质量分 76
threedr3am
https://threedr3am.github.io
展开
-
MongoDB菜鸟入门(三):创建用户使用鉴权、使用聚合aggregate
一、创建用户创建管理员账户//以--auth启动数据库服务器mongod --dbpath=C:\data\shard\test --port 27000 --auth//以admin登录且切换到admin数据库mongo admin --port 27000//创建管理员db.createUser({user:"root",pwd:"12345",roles:["userA原创 2017-08-09 09:42:54 · 528 阅读 · 0 评论 -
MongoDB菜鸟入门(一):概念与增删改查、建立索引
一、启动指定–dbpath为存储文件夹,使用默认端口启动mongod.exe --dbpath c:\data\db二、windows添加服务若要把mongodb设定为windows服务mongod.exe --bind_ip yourIPadress --logpath "C:\data\dbConf\mongodb.log" --logappend --dbpath "C:\data\db" -原创 2017-08-05 11:06:21 · 697 阅读 · 0 评论 -
MongoDB菜鸟入门(二):使用分片和主从副本实行高性能髙可靠数据库
上一篇简单的记录了一下本人的学习笔记,下面描述的是如何配置分片和主从副本集。一、分片由于使用一些传统的数据库(例:mysql等)数据存储量一旦达到某种程度后,查询操作可能会非常耗时,而使用某些内存数据库(例:redis等)则受内存空间大小的限制。而使用mongodb分布式数据库则可以解决此些问题。此处笔记记录了我个人使用了两个分片实践,由于没有更多的机器,此处仅使用单台主机实践。分片1(sha原创 2017-08-05 11:30:22 · 574 阅读 · 0 评论 -
MongoDB上MapReduce的实现以及项目实例探索
0x01 数据存储结构前段时间发现公司原来的一个业务,使用mysql分月创建表记录用户登陆记录信息,在表数量达到千万级后,查询变得超级慢,并且时不时的卡死终端,为了解决这个问题,没有选择花大力气去优化,而是选择了使用MongoDB数据库去存储,记过几个月的数据存储,数据量早已达到五千万级别,但查询速度依然很快。MongoDB存储了大量的用户登录记录,文档结构如下:{ "_id" :原创 2018-01-12 15:35:46 · 2154 阅读 · 1 评论